About WCC
Western Community College is a privately held provider of post-secondary education in British Columbia, offering a Bachelor of Hospitality Management degree program and more than 60 career training diploma and certificate programs in the fields of business, accounting, healthcare, education, hospitality, information technology, legal studies, and warehousing, using industry-based market-driven curriculums. Job Title: EA (Education Assistant) Instructor
Responsibilities
Theory Instruction (In-Person or Online)
Deliver lectures aligned with course objectives and program learning outcomes.
Prepare lesson plans, presentations, and materials that engage diverse learners.
Explain course outlines, expectations, and assessment criteria at the start of each course.
Provide regular feedback on student progress and support student learning needs.
Assess assignments and exams and submit grades within required timelines.
Participate in curriculum development, updates, and instructional planning.
General Responsibilities (All Instructors)
Discuss students’ progress and address academic concerns as needed.
Submit all required records and documentation, including attendance and grades, in a timely manner and in accordance with institutional policies and established processes. Accurately track and report student attendance and grades through the system as required .
Attend faculty meetings and participate in program and college initiatives.
Participate in faculty performance reviews, if required .
Arrange make-up sessions for hours missed due to illness or other absences.
Comply with all college pol icies and procedures.
Perform other duties as assigned by the Program manage r, College Dean, or President.
Education and Experience Required:
A certificate, diploma, or degree in an Education/ Education Assistant or a field directly related to the subject area being taught.
A minimum of two years of related work experience in the subject area.
In the absence of formal education, a minimum of ten years of relevant work experience may be considered.
